[0001] The present invention relates to the field of steering gears, in particular to a multi-stage gear type full electric power steering gear. Background Art

[0002] The electric power steering system is a power steering system that directly relies on the motor to provide auxiliary torque. Compared with the traditional hydraulic power steering system, the electric power steering system has many advantages. The electric power steering system is mainly composed of a torque sensor, a vehicle speed sensor, an electric motor, a reduction mechanism and an electronic control unit (ECU).

[0003] During use, the steering gear used in the vehicle uses a torque sensor to detect the torque of the steering wheel, and then controls the start of the motor, which drives the recirculating ball steering gear to steer (for large torque). In actual use, since it mainly relies on the rolling of the internal steel balls, it is necessary to ensure that the steel balls are sufficiently lubricated during the transmission process. Insufficient lubrication will cause friction between the rolling steel balls and the threads, which will cause wear of the steel balls, thereby affecting the service life of the recirculating ball steering gear. Although there is also a rack and pinion steering, the contact surface of this type is small and cannot be used for larger torques. Summary of the Invention

[0004] In view of the problem that the electric power-assisted recirculating ball steering gear mentioned above or in the prior art mainly relies on the rolling of the internal steel balls, it is necessary to ensure that the steel balls are sufficiently lubricated during the transmission process. If the lubrication is insufficient, the friction between the rolling of the steel balls and the threads will cause wear of the steel balls, thereby affecting the service life of the recirculating ball steering gear, the present invention is proposed.

[0013] Beneficial effects of the multi-stage gear-type all-electric power steering device of the present invention: 1. The present invention adopts the design of two sets of planetary gears, which has a larger gear contact area and 360-degree uniform load. Multiple gear surfaces jointly and evenly bear the instantaneous impact load, making it more able to withstand higher torque impact without damage or cracking. At the same time, the planetary reduction power steering device has a simple technical structure and a small number of parts. It does not need to consider sealing and high lubricity through gear transmission, and has lower maintenance costs and better reliability.

[0014] 2. By setting the first-stage pinion and the second-stage pinion as helical gears, during the transmission process, the first-stage pinion and the second-stage pinion are symmetrically arranged, the axial forces offset each other, reducing bearing wear and extending service life.

[0015] 3. By setting the worm gear to drive the second planetary carrier to move, and the power-assisting motor to drive the second planetary carrier to move, two control methods are realized, and the control is more stable. In addition, when the power-assisting motor is damaged, short-term steering control can still be performed. BRIEF DESCRIPTION OF THE DRAWINGS

[0028] Reference Figures 1 to 8 A multi-stage gear-type full-electric power steering device includes a steering mechanism, including an intermediate housing 10, a secondary planetary carrier 11 arranged in the intermediate housing 10, and an output shaft 12 fixedly connected to the secondary planetary carrier 11; a first power mechanism, including a core shaft assembly housing 20 arranged at the left end of the intermediate housing 10 and communicated with the intermediate housing 10, an input shaft 21 is provided on the core shaft assembly housing 20, a first planetary assembly 22 and a second planetary assembly 23 for providing power for the rotation of the output shaft 12 are provided in the intermediate housing 10, and a rotating assembly 24 for providing power for the second planetary assembly 23 is provided in the core shaft assembly housing 20; a second power mechanism, including a motor assembly housing 30 arranged at the right end of the intermediate housing 10 and communicated with the intermediate housing 10, a power-assist motor 31 is provided in the motor assembly housing 30, and a transmission assembly 32 for providing power for the first planetary assembly 22 is provided at the output end of the power-assist motor 31, and a control assembly 33 for controlling the start of the power-assist motor 31 is provided outside the core shaft assembly housing 20.

[0029] Specifically, the output shaft 12 here is connected to the boom of the vehicle steering, and steering is performed by rotating the output shaft 12. The outer end of the input shaft 21 is connected to the converter, and the end of the converter is connected to the steering wheel. When the steering wheel rotates, the input shaft 21 rotates through transmission. The power-assisted motor 31 here can rotate forward and reverse. The power-assisted motor 31 here is existing technology and will not be described here.

[0030] Furthermore, the first planetary assembly 22 includes a first rotating shaft 221 rotatably connected to the intermediate housing 10, a secondary large gear 222 is fixedly connected to the first rotating shaft 221, a primary sun gear 223 is fixedly connected to the first rotating shaft 221, a primary planetary carrier 224 is provided on the upper side of the primary sun gear 223, a second rotating shaft is fixedly connected to the primary planetary carrier 224, and a primary planetary gear 225 meshing with the primary sun gear 223 is rotatably connected to the second rotating shaft; the second planetary assembly 23 includes a secondary sun gear 231 fixedly connected to the primary planetary carrier 224, a secondary planetary carrier 11 is provided on the upper side of the secondary sun gear 231, the secondary planetary carrier 11 is fixedly connected to the output shaft 12, a plurality of shaft bodies are fixedly connected to the secondary planetary carrier 11, and the plurality of shaft bodies are rotatably connected to secondary planetary gears 232 meshing with the secondary sun gear 231.

[0031] Among them, the first-level sun gear 223 and the second-level large gear 222 are arranged in the upper and lower positions, the first-level sun gear 223 is at the upper end of the second-level large gear 222, the second-level planetary gears 232 and the first-level planetary gears 225 are arranged in the upper and lower positions, and the multiple second-level planetary gears 232 and the multiple first-level planetary gears 225 are divided into two layers, and the multiple first-level planetary gears 225 are located on the lower side of the multiple second-level planetary gears 232.

[0032] Preferably, the secondary planetary carrier 11 is provided with a sector plate 233 fixedly connected, and the intermediate housing 10 is provided with a notch 234 that cooperates with the sector plate 233; the intermediate housing 10 is fixedly connected with a first ring gear 235 and a second ring gear 236, the first ring gear 235 and the second ring gear 236 are respectively engaged with the primary planetary gear 225 and the secondary planetary gear 232, and the first ring gear 235 and the second ring gear 236 are fixedly connected by a plurality of fixing columns 237; the rotating assembly 24 includes a torsion bar 241 fixedly connected to the input shaft 21, and the torsion bar 241 is fixedly connected to a worm 242 at one end away from the input shaft 21, and a worm wheel 243 engaged with the worm 242 is fixedly connected to the secondary planetary carrier 11.

[0033] It should be noted that the first-stage planetary gear 225 is meshed with the first-stage sun gear 223 and the first ring gear 235. When the first-stage sun gear 223 rotates, it will drive multiple first-stage planetary gears 225 to rotate around the first-stage sun gear 223. The first ring gear 235 and the second ring gear 236 here are both inner ring gears. A protrusion is provided on the intermediate housing 10, and a groove that matches the protrusion is provided on the outer side wall of the first ring gear 235 and the second ring gear 236. The protrusion and the groove cooperate to prevent the first ring gear 235 and the second ring gear 236 from self-rotating.

[0034] Furthermore, the transmission assembly 32 includes a first-stage pinion 321 fixedly connected to the output end of the power-assisting motor 31, a support shaft is rotatably connected in the motor assembly housing 30, a first-stage large gear 322 is fixedly connected to the support shaft and meshed with the first-stage pinion 321, a second-stage pinion 323 is fixedly connected to the first-stage large gear 322, and the second-stage pinion 323 meshes with the second-stage large gear 222; the control assembly 33 includes an ECU controller 331 fixedly connected to the core shaft assembly housing 20, the ECU controller 331 cooperates with the torsion bar 241, and a torque sensor is integrated in the ECU controller 331 for detecting the rotation of the torsion bar 241 (this is the existing technology and will not be described in detail here). The motor assembly housing 30 is provided with a start-stop controller 332 for controlling the power-assisting motor 31.

[0035] It is worth noting that there is a buffer pad between the four claws of the power-boosting motor 31 (the four claws are also called the stator or stator of the power-boosting motor 31) and the first-stage pinion 321. Its function is that when the power-boosting motor 31 is running, a sudden stop will generate inertia and recoil force inside the power-boosting motor 31, causing impact and damage to the internal components of the power-boosting motor 31. The buffer of the power-boosting motor 31 can reduce the possibility of the power-boosting motor 31 stopping suddenly, thereby reducing damage to the internal components of the power-boosting motor 31 and extending the life of the power-boosting motor 31.

[0036] During use, the steering wheel rotates through the transmission to deflect the input shaft 21, and the output shaft 12 rotates to rotate the worm 242, thereby rotating the worm 242, driving the secondary planetary carrier 11 to deflect, causing the output shaft 12 to rotate, deflecting the boom, and realizing steering. When steering, the fan-shaped plate 233 on the secondary planetary carrier 11 cooperates with the notch 234 to limit the rotation angle of the secondary planetary carrier 11, avoid oversteering, and ensure steering stability. It is worth noting that the steering wheel is not directly fixed to the input shaft 21, and a converter is provided in the middle, so that the deflection angle of the steering wheel will be larger than that of the secondary planetary carrier 11, which will not affect the steering wheel.

[0037] When the input shaft 21 rotates, the torsion bar 241 deflects. The amount of rotation of the torsion bar 241 reflects the required rotation angle. At this time, the sensor detects the deflection and feeds it back to the ECU. The controller then controls the power-assist motor 31 to rotate through the start-stop controller 332. The power-assist motor 31 provides an output torque of appropriate size. The output end of the power-assist motor 31 rotates to drive the first-stage pinion 321 to rotate, so that the first-stage large gear 322 meshing with the first-stage pinion 321 rotates, thereby supporting the shaft to rotate, driving the second-stage pinion 323 to rotate, so that the second-stage large gear 222 meshing with the second-stage pinion 323 rotates. It is worth noting that the number of teeth of the first-stage pinion 321 here is less than that of the first-stage large gear 322, and the number of teeth of the second-stage pinion 323 is less than that of the second-stage large gear 222. Therefore, when the output end of the power-assist motor 31 rotates, it is always decelerating. Since there is a negative correlation between the torque and the speed of the power-assist motor 31, sufficient torque is guaranteed for transmission during deceleration. The first-stage pinion 321 and the second-stage pinion 323 here are both helical gears. At the same time, the two helical gears are symmetrically designed, and the axial forces offset each other, reducing bearing wear and improving service life.

[0038] Since the primary sun gear 223 is fixed to the secondary large gear 222, the primary sun gear 223 rotates, driving multiple primary planetary gears 225 to rotate around the primary sun gear 223, driving the primary planetary carrier 224 to rotate. Since the secondary sun gear 231 is fixed to the primary planetary carrier 224, the secondary sun gear 231 rotates, causing multiple secondary planetary gears 232 to rotate, and the secondary planetary carrier 11 to rotate. Since the output shaft 12 is fixed to the secondary planetary carrier 11, the rotation of the output end of the power-assist motor 31 can also drive the output shaft 12 to rotate. The secondary planetary carrier 11 is driven to rotate by the rotation of the turbine and the rotation of the output shaft 12 of the power-assist motor 31, making steering more labor-saving. It is worth noting that the above method uses the primary planetary gear 225 and the secondary planetary gear 232 to perform the transmission rod. Its advantage is that it has a larger area of ​​gear contact, 360-degree uniform load, and multiple gear surfaces jointly and evenly bear the instantaneous impact load, making it more able to withstand higher torque impacts without being damaged or broken.

[0039] Reference Figure 9 The present invention also designs a semi-redundant solution for use with the ECU controller, as follows: The ECU controller 331 adopts a semi-redundant solution, and its internal components are a single PMIC, a single MCU, a single CAN transceiver, a dual MOSFET pre-driver chip, and a dual three-phase MOSFET full-bridge. The MCU chip and the MOSFET pre-driver chip determine the status of the two sets of motor drive circuits through SPI communication, thereby realizing the switching of the two sets of power-assisting motor 31 drive circuits; the sensor supporting the ECU controller 331 is designed as a redundant sensor, and its internal sensor has two independent 5V power supply networks, as well as two independent torque detection circuits. Each detection circuit outputs two independent torque control signals; dual-winding motor: There are two completely independent windings, which act on a rotor together. Each winding has an independent phase line terminal. If a winding circuit fails, the other winding can provide 50% of the rated torque of the power-assisting motor 31.
